We have seen a lot...well, maybe not, since my last roster prediction after the Redskins played the Ravens. Sunday's game saw the starters play a bit into the third quarter, and who was out there, and who wasn't, says a lot about who should make this roster.

Some standout performances and injuries have effected my last roster projections. Below, you can get a look at who I think will make the Redskins 53-man roster.

Notes:

*I have the Redskins carrying just 8 offensive linemen, and 5 outside linebackers. This could easily be 9 OL and 4 OLB. I feel they will try and put three of their young linemen on the practice squad, and I do not feel Vinston Painter is worth a roster spot at this time.

*I have the battle at CB and S leaving out veteran Will Blackmon in favor of a younger rookie in Holsey (who has played well). Nicholson, in limited action, has shown he belongs.
